A problem occurred in a Python script. Here is the
sequence of function calls leading up to the error, in the
order they occurred.
/usr/lib/pymodules/python2.7/MoinMoin/request/__init__.py
in run
(self=<MoinMoin.request.request_cgi.Request object>)
- 1309 self.page.send_page()
- 1310 else:
- 1311 handler(self.page.page_name, self)
- 1312
- 1313 # every action that didn't use to raise MoinMoinFinish must call this now:
- handler
= <function do_show>
- self
= <MoinMoin.request.request_cgi.Request object>
- self.page
= <MoinMoin.Page.Page object>
- self.page.page_name
= u'Development/Blueprints/simulator-singleton/UMLSequenceChart'
/usr/lib/pymodules/python2.7/MoinMoin/action/__init__.py
in do_show
(pagename=u'Development/Blueprints/simulator-singleton/UMLSequenceChart', request=<MoinMoin.request.request_cgi.Request object>, content_only=0, count_hit=1, cacheable=1, print_mode=0)
- 251 count_hit=count_hit,
- 252 print_mode=print_mode,
- 253 content_only=content_only,
- 254 )
- 255
/usr/lib/pymodules/python2.7/MoinMoin/Page.py
in send_page
(self=<MoinMoin.Page.Page object>, **keywords={'content_only': 0, 'count_hit': 1, 'print_mode': 0})
- 1171 media=media, pi_refresh=pi.get('refresh'),
- 1172 allow_doubleclick=1, trail=trail,
- 1173 html_head=html_head,
- 1174 )
- 1175
/usr/lib/pymodules/python2.7/MoinMoin/theme/__init__.py
in send_title
(self=<MoinMoin.theme.rightsidebar.Theme instance>, text=u'Development/Blueprints/simulator-singleton/UMLSequenceChart', **keywords={'allow_doubleclick': 1, 'html_head': '', 'media': 'screen', 'page': <MoinMoin.Page.Page object>, 'pi_refresh': None, 'print_mode': 0, 'trail': []})
- 1793 output.append(self.editorheader(d))
- 1794 else:
- 1795 output.append(self.header(d))
- 1796
- 1797 # emit it
- output
= [u'\n<body lang="en" dir="ltr">\n']
- output.append
= <built-in method append of list object>
- self
= <MoinMoin.theme.rightsidebar.Theme instance>
- self.header
= <bound method Theme.header of <MoinMoin.theme.rightsidebar.Theme instance>>
- d
= {'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...}
/usr/lib/pymodules/python2.7/MoinMoin/theme/rightsidebar.py
in header
(self=<MoinMoin.theme.rightsidebar.Theme instance>, d={'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...})
- 83 u'<div id="sidebar">',
- 84 self.wikipanel(d),
- 85 self.pagepanel(d),
- 86 self.userpanel(d),
- 87 u'</div>',
- self
= <MoinMoin.theme.rightsidebar.Theme instance>
- self.pagepanel
= <bound method Theme.pagepanel of <MoinMoin.theme.rightsidebar.Theme instance>>
- d
= {'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...}
/usr/lib/pymodules/python2.7/MoinMoin/theme/rightsidebar.py
in pagepanel
(self=<MoinMoin.theme.rightsidebar.Theme instance>, d={'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...})
- 34 u'<div class="sidepanel">',
- 35 u'<h1>%s</h1>' % _("Page"),
- 36 self.editbar(d),
- 37 u'</div>',
- 38 ]
- self
= <MoinMoin.theme.rightsidebar.Theme instance>
- self.editbar
= <bound method Theme.editbar of <MoinMoin.theme.rightsidebar.Theme instance>>
- d
= {'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...}
/usr/lib/pymodules/python2.7/MoinMoin/theme/__init__.py
in editbar
(self=<MoinMoin.theme.rightsidebar.Theme instance>, d={'available_actions': ['use self.request.availableActions(page)'], 'baseurl': '/Wiki', 'home_page': None, 'last_edit_info': {'editor': u'<span title="??? @ localhost[127.0.0.1]">localhost</span>', 'time': '2008-08-21 10:50:51'}, 'logo_string': u'<em><font color="#FF6600">open</font></em><font ...333">WNS</font> - open Wireless Network Simulator', 'msg': [], 'navibar': ['use self.navibar(d)'], 'page': <MoinMoin.Page.Page object>, 'page_find_page': 'FindPage', 'page_front_page': u'Home', ...})
- 1116 # comments exist on the page.
- 1117 items = []
- 1118 for item in self.editbarItems(page):
- 1119 if item:
- 1120 if 'nbcomment' in item:
- item undefined
- self
= <MoinMoin.theme.rightsidebar.Theme instance>
- self.editbarItems
= <bound method Theme.editbarItems of <MoinMoin.theme.rightsidebar.Theme instance>>
- page
= <MoinMoin.Page.Page object>
/usr/lib/pymodules/python2.7/MoinMoin/theme/__init__.py
in editbarItems
(self=<MoinMoin.theme.rightsidebar.Theme instance>, page=<MoinMoin.Page.Page object>)
- 1182 editbar_actions.append(self.attachmentsLink(page))
- 1183 elif editbar_item == 'ActionsMenu':
- 1184 editbar_actions.append(self.actionsMenu(page))
- 1185 return editbar_actions
- 1186
- editbar_actions
= ['<span class="disabled">Immutable Page</span>', '<a href="#" class="nbcomment" onClick="toggleComments();return false;">Comments</a>', '<a class="nbinfo" href="/Wiki/Development/Bluepr...equenceChart?action=info" rel="nofollow">Info</a>', '', '', '<a class="nbattachments" href="/Wiki/Development...action=AttachFile" rel="nofollow">Attachments</a>']
- editbar_actions.append
= <built-in method append of list object>
- self
= <MoinMoin.theme.rightsidebar.Theme instance>
- self.actionsMenu
= <bound method Theme.actionsMenu of <MoinMoin.theme.rightsidebar.Theme instance>>
- page
= <MoinMoin.Page.Page object>
/usr/lib/pymodules/python2.7/MoinMoin/theme/__init__.py
in actionsMenu
(self=<MoinMoin.theme.rightsidebar.Theme instance>, page=<MoinMoin.Page.Page object>)
- 999 # Enable delete cache only if page can use caching
- 1000 if action == 'refresh':
- 1001 if not page.canUseCache():
- 1002 data['action'] = 'show'
- 1003 data['disabled'] = disabled
- page
= <MoinMoin.Page.Page object>
- page.canUseCache
= <bound method Page.canUseCache of <MoinMoin.Page.Page object>>
/usr/lib/pymodules/python2.7/MoinMoin/Page.py
in canUseCache
(self=<MoinMoin.Page.Page object>, parser=None)
- 1264 # Everything is fine, now check the parser:
- 1265 if parser is None:
- 1266 parser = wikiutil.searchAndImportPlugin(self.request.cfg, "parser", self.pi['format'])
- 1267 return getattr(parser, 'caching', False)
- 1268 return False
- parser
= None
- global
wikiutil
= <module 'MoinMoin.wikiutil' from '/usr/lib/pymodules/python2.7/MoinMoin/wikiutil.pyc'>
- wikiutil.searchAndImportPlugin
= <function searchAndImportPlugin>
- self
= <MoinMoin.Page.Page object>
- self.request
= <MoinMoin.request.request_cgi.Request object>
- self.request.cfg
= <openWNS.Config object>
- self.pi
= {'acl': <MoinMoin.security.AccessControlList instance>, 'format': u'umlsequence', 'formatargs': u'', 'language': 'en', 'lines': 1}
/usr/lib/pymodules/python2.7/MoinMoin/wikiutil.py
in searchAndImportPlugin
(cfg=<openWNS.Config object>, type='parser', name=u'umlsequence', what='Parser')
- 1235 for module_name in mt.module_name():
- 1236 try:
- 1237 plugin = importPlugin(cfg, type, module_name, what)
- 1238 break
- 1239 except PluginMissingError:
- plugin
= None
- global
importPlugin
= <function importPlugin>
- cfg
= <openWNS.Config object>
- type
= 'parser'
- module_name
= u'umlsequence'
- what
= 'Parser'
/usr/lib/pymodules/python2.7/MoinMoin/wikiutil.py
in importPlugin
(cfg=<openWNS.Config object>, kind='parser', name=u'umlsequence', function='Parser')
- 1112 """
- 1113 try:
- 1114 return importWikiPlugin(cfg, kind, name, function)
- 1115 except PluginMissingError:
- 1116 return importBuiltinPlugin(kind, name, function)
- global
importWikiPlugin
= <function importWikiPlugin>
- cfg
= <openWNS.Config object>
- kind
= 'parser'
- name
= u'umlsequence'
- function
= 'Parser'
/usr/lib/pymodules/python2.7/MoinMoin/wikiutil.py
in importWikiPlugin
(cfg=<openWNS.Config object>, kind='parser', name=u'umlsequence', function='Parser')
- 1127 raise PluginMissingError()
- 1128 moduleName = '%s.%s' % (modname, name)
- 1129 return importNameFromPlugin(moduleName, function)
- 1130
- 1131
- global
importNameFromPlugin
= <function importNameFromPlugin>
- moduleName
= u'openWNS.p_4948dea59bed09bba732b8dd8593c5df10b8148c.parser.umlsequence'
- function
= 'Parser'
/usr/lib/pymodules/python2.7/MoinMoin/wikiutil.py
in importNameFromPlugin
(moduleName=u'openWNS.p_4948dea59bed09bba732b8dd8593c5df10b8148c.parser.umlsequence', name='Parser')
- 1151 else:
- 1152 fromlist = [name]
- 1153 module = __import__(moduleName, globals(), {}, fromlist)
- 1154 if fromlist:
- 1155 # module has the obj for module <moduleName>
- module undefined
- builtin
__import__
= <built-in function __import__>
- moduleName
= u'openWNS.p_4948dea59bed09bba732b8dd8593c5df10b8148c.parser.umlsequence'
- builtin
globals
= <built-in function globals>
- fromlist
= ['Parser']
SyntaxError
Non-ASCII character '\xab' in file /var/www/openwns.org/Wiki/data/plugin/parser/umlsequence.py on line 250, but no encoding declared; see http://www.python.org/peps/pep-0263.html for details (umlsequence.py, line 249)
- args = (r"Non-ASCII character '\xab' in file /var/www/open...p://www.python.org/peps/pep-0263.html for details", ('/var/www/openwns.org/Wiki/data/plugin/parser/umlsequence.py', 249, 0, None))
- filename = '/var/www/openwns.org/Wiki/data/plugin/parser/umlsequence.py'
- lineno = 249
- message = ''
- msg = r"Non-ASCII character '\xab' in file /var/www/open...p://www.python.org/peps/pep-0263.html for details"
- offset = 0
- print_file_and_line = None
- text = None